Kangrim

Kangrim KEV 1t/16bar

Kangrim Kangrim KEV 1t/16bar is identified in the source list as a marine steam boiler. It is normally installed in the engine room or boiler area with its burner, feedwater, steam, fuel and combustion-air systems. Its purpose is to generate steam for fuel heating, tank heating, domestic services, cargo duties or other shipboard consumers when exhaust-gas heat alone is unavailable or insufficient. The existing database record identifies HFO/MDO as the stated fuel service. The boiler combines a pressure-containing heating surface with a burner and combustion system, but the exact furnace and tube arrangement must be confirmed from the manufacturer documentation. The exact model designation and any source-listed fuel or pressure information distinguish this boiler from neighboring variants; steam output and design limits must be confirmed from approved manufacturer documentation.

Technical Data

boiler type auxiliary_oil-fired_boiler
steam capacity th 1
design pressure bar 16
fuel type HFO/MDO

Common failures & inspection points

Burner ignition or flame failure caused by fuel contamination, poor atomization, electrode faults or air-supply problems, resulting in failed starts, flame trips or unstable combustion
Soot or deposit buildup on heating surfaces caused by poor combustion or unsuitable fuel condition, resulting in rising exhaust temperature and reduced steam-generation efficiency
Low-water or feedwater-control problems caused by valve, pump, sensor or control faults, resulting in unstable drum level or protective shutdowns
Tube or pressure-part leakage caused by corrosion, overheating or fatigue, resulting in water loss, steam leakage or abnormal furnace conditions
Safety or combustion-control device malfunction caused by fouling, calibration drift or electrical faults, resulting in alarms, trips or unsafe operating indications

Service & Maintenance

Inspect burner components, flame safeguards, fuel valves, atomizing equipment, furnace condition and combustion-air path. Maintain feedwater treatment and check water-level controls, gauge glasses, blowdown arrangements and safety devices in accordance with approved procedures. Trend steam pressure, firing behavior and exhaust condition for signs of fouling or poor combustion. Inspect accessible pressure parts for leakage, corrosion and signs of overheating and clean heating surfaces as required. Function-test interlocks and alarms before returning the boiler to automatic service after maintenance. Refer to the manufacturer and class documentation for exact pressure settings, water chemistry limits, inspection intervals and acceptance criteria.

Replacement Parts

Keep burner nozzles or atomizing parts as applicable, ignition components, flame-detection parts, fuel-valve service kits, gaskets, gauge-glass consumables and selected control components recommended by the manufacturer. Pressure-part repair material and safety-valve parts should follow approved vessel and class procedures. Confirm exact spares from the boiler model and burner configuration.
